here is the hatch that my homemade air cooled light sits in ,
the extractor fan that is the highest is the fan dedicated to the light (i also have a fan intaking air into the hatch when it is shut) the lower fan is dedicated to the grow room and is also wired into a regulator which you will see later in this thread

the d.o.c
i blast all hot air from the light fan straight out the wall
the d.o.c
a standard low voltage light dimmer wil not be sufficient to regulate the fans ,so i asked my local elctrical wholesaler what type of regulator is?
here it is (it even has a wee fan picture on it)

the white trunking you see leading down from the last pictur is the intake fan and the wire that you seen leading round the back of the unit is the outlet for the grow room alone (this helps manage humidity)

here is the fan below the regulator

above you can see a picture which shows the acrylic heat shield which i drilled air holes in ,i installed it directly below the outlet fan in the grow room so i would have the air being sucked through the drilled air holes up and out the fan

i have recently converted a chest of drawers to be my new clone veg area ,all that was needed was two twin 2feet flouro fittings and a bit of black and white
the d.o.c
the handy thing about it being a chest of drawers is that as the plants grow in hieght i can lower the drawer to accomodate  ;)
